Wikipedia, June 13, 2016 (George Radcliffe Colton, b. April 10, 1865, in Galesburg, Ill; d. April 06, 1916; governor of Puerto Rico from Nov. 06, 1909-Nov. 05, 1913; appointed by Pres. William Howard Taft; in the 1880s he was a rancher in New Territory; served in the Nebraska House of Representatives 1889-1890; was a bank examiner in Nebraska; served in the United States Army in the 1st Nebraska Volunteer Infantry Regiment, commissioned a lieutenant colonel; stationed in the Philippines, Dominican Republic, and Puerto Rico)
